Python:通用编程语言的魅力与高效解决方案
4星 · 超过85%的资源 需积分: 9 200 浏览量
更新于2024-09-12
1
收藏 344KB DOCX 举报
标题:"完全用Python工作--- Harness the Power of Python" 描述:这篇文章探讨了如何利用Python这种通用且强大的编程语言来满足各种IT需求,从科学计算、数据分析到Web开发,甚至包括创建简单的HTTP服务器。Python以其易学性和高效性,成为业余物理工作者和初学者的理想选择,因为它能够在许多领域替代其他复杂语言如C和C++,如无需深入底层操作就能完成复杂任务。
文章强调了Python作为通用语言的优势,它提供了丰富的库和工具,使得开发者能够快速上手,并且在功能上不逊于C++等语言。Python的动态类型、简洁语法和模块化设计降低了学习曲线,特别是对于那些追求效率提升而非专门从事嵌入式开发或对性能极端敏感的用户来说,Python是一个理想的解决方案。
作者列举了不推荐使用C和C++的理由,如C的低级特性可能导致程序员频繁遇到指针问题,而C++的学习曲线陡峭且初期投入时间较长。相比之下,Python通过抽象避免了这些问题,使开发过程更加愉快和高效。
此外,文章还提到了Python在不同领域的应用广泛性,包括但不限于科学计算(如处理能带)、数据处理、脚本编写、图形界面构建、网络服务等,这些都是其他语言难以比拟的。作者认为,即使在大型项目中,Python也能作为主要开发工具,通过与其他语言如C进行适当结合,提供80%的解决方案。
"完全用Python工作"并不是指所有人都必须这样做,而是针对那些寻求效率提升、跨领域工作的个人,以及对编程有一定基础但不想深陷语言特性的琐碎细节中的用户。Python以其平衡的性能、易用性和生态系统,成为了现代IT工作中不可或缺的一部分。
2013-03-05 上传
2016-06-08 上传
2018-07-25 上传
226 浏览量
423 浏览量
2017-07-06 上传
126 浏览量
2016-04-16 上传
422 浏览量
Detectiveliu
- 粉丝: 0
- 资源: 5
最新资源
- Raspberry Pi OpenCL驱动程序安装与QEMU仿真指南
- Apache RocketMQ Go客户端:全面支持与消息处理功能
- WStage平台:无线传感器网络阶段数据交互技术
- 基于Java SpringBoot和微信小程序的ssm智能仓储系统开发
- CorrectMe项目:自动更正与建议API的开发与应用
- IdeaBiz请求处理程序JAVA:自动化API调用与令牌管理
- 墨西哥面包店研讨会:介绍关键业绩指标(KPI)与评估标准
- 2014年Android音乐播放器源码学习分享
- CleverRecyclerView扩展库:滑动效果与特性增强
- 利用Python和SURF特征识别斑点猫图像
- Wurpr开源PHP MySQL包装器:安全易用且高效
- Scratch少儿编程:Kanon妹系闹钟音效素材包
- 食品分享社交应用的开发教程与功能介绍
- Cookies by lfj.io: 浏览数据智能管理与同步工具
- 掌握SSH框架与SpringMVC Hibernate集成教程
- C语言实现FFT算法及互相关性能优化指南